Antwerp

Antwerp is a very popular tourist destination in Belgium. It's a lovely city in the region of Flanders and its people are known for their friendly, open and welcoming personalities. It's a very relaxed and low stress city, making it an excellent place to spend a few days in the midst of a hectic trip. The city itself is known to have a very high standard of living and a great quality of life. Antwerp is also an economic center in Belgium, because of its importance in the diamond trade. It is known as the "world's leading diamond city" with about seventy percent of all diamonds traded through Antwerp.

Saint Croix

Sometimes all you want out of a vacation is the warmth of the sun, the sound of the waves and the taste of a cold drink. No more. No less. That's exactly what you can expect in St. Croix.

The largest of the U.S. Virgin Islands, St. Croix is a place of our leisure and relaxation. It's a bit of an expensive lifestyle for its 50,000 residents and daily visitors, but when you're living on island time, money is never a worry. There are no worries on island time.

This once volcanic island is covered in incredible beaches, stunning mountains, palm tress in the wind and historic colonial towns. While they may be a bit old and rundown, the Danish architecture still stands as a unique part of this island's legacy. Don't expect much window-shopping, though. That was not a feature incorporated in this style of architecture. If you want to know if a store is open, just step on in, but remember, shop hours are also running on island time.

  • Average Daily Cost Per person, per day
    Antwerp $178
    Saint Croix $277

The average daily cost (per person) in Antwerp is $178, while the average daily cost in Saint Croix is $277.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. When is the best time to visit Antwerp or Saint Croix?

Antwerp has a temperate climate with four distinct seasons, but Saint Croix experiences a warm climate with fairly sunny weather most of the year.

Should I visit Antwerp or Saint Croix in the Summer?

The summer attracts plenty of travelers to both Antwerp and Saint Croix. Most visitors come to Antwerp for the city activities and the family-friendly experiences during these months. Saint Croix attracts visitors year-round for its warm weather and sunny climate.

Antwerp is much colder than Saint Croix in the summer. The daily temperature in Antwerp averages around 17°C (63°F) in July, and Saint Croix fluctuates around 29°C (83°F).

In July, Antwerp usually receives around the same amount of rain as Saint Croix. Antwerp gets 66 mm (2.6 in) of rain, while Saint Croix receives 66 mm (2.6 in) of rain each month for the summer.

Typical Weather for Saint Croix and Antwerp

Antwerp Saint Croix
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 3°C (38°F) 59 mm (2.3 in) 26°C (78°F) 43 mm (1.7 in)
Feb 3°C (38°F) 44 mm (1.7 in) 26°C (78°F) 39 mm (1.5 in)
Mar 6°C (42°F) 55 mm (2.2 in) 26°C (79°F) 49 mm (1.9 in)
Apr 8°C (47°F) 45 mm (1.8 in) 27°C (80°F) 72 mm (2.8 in)
May 12°C (54°F) 49 mm (1.9 in) 28°C (82°F) 94 mm (3.7 in)
Jun 15°C (59°F) 62 mm (2.4 in) 28°C (83°F) 64 mm (2.5 in)
Jul 17°C (63°F) 66 mm (2.6 in) 29°C (83°F) 66 mm (2.6 in)
Aug 18°C (64°F) 67 mm (2.6 in) 29°C (84°F) 101 mm (4 in)
Sep 16°C (60°F) 62 mm (2.4 in) 28°C (83°F) 127 mm (5 in)
Oct 12°C (54°F) 78 mm (3.1 in) 28°C (82°F) 146 mm (5.7 in)
Nov 7°C (45°F) 75 mm (2.9 in) 27°C (81°F) 126 mm (4.9 in)
Dec 5°C (40°F) 71 mm (2.8 in) 26°C (80°F) 71 mm (2.8 in)
